Accelerating Action through Thought Transformation
Transforming thoughts into tangible actions is a critical skill in any field, particularly in the realm of artificial intelligence and technology. The process involves more than just generating ideas; it requires a structured approach that converts abstract concepts into practical outcomes. Understanding how to effectively bridge the gap between ideation and execution can significantly enhance productivity and innovation.
The Importance of Context
When embarking on a project or task, providing contextual information is vital for clarity and direction. A well-defined context serves several purposes:
-
Enhances Understanding: Just as an artist benefits from knowing their medium, developers thrive when they understand the environment in which they are working. This includes familiarity with programming languages, tools, and frameworks.
-
Informs Better Decisions: Contextual awareness helps identify the most suitable methods and technologies for specific tasks. For instance, choosing between different AI models may depend on the problem being solved—whether it’s natural language processing or image recognition.
-
Guides Collaboration: In team settings, ensuring everyone has a shared understanding of the project’s context fosters collaboration and reduces misunderstandings.
Utilizing Technological Tools
Various tools can aid in transforming thoughts into actions by streamlining processes and enhancing efficiency:
-
Integrated Development Environments (IDEs): Platforms like Visual Studio Code or IntelliJ IDEA provide features such as code completion and syntax highlighting that guide programmers through their development journey. These tools assist not only with writing code but also with debugging and optimizing it.
-
Code Completion Tools: Intelligent assistants like GitHub Copilot can suggest lines of code based on context, reducing the time spent on manual coding tasks. For example, when writing a function to validate phone numbers, Copilot suggests appropriate patterns automatically.
Leveraging Generative AI
Generative AI models have revolutionized how we approach problem-solving:
-
Contextual Awareness: Models like GPT-4 excel at producing accurate outputs when given sufficient context about recent developments or specific tasks. This could range from understanding new programming syntax to generating complex algorithms tailored to user needs.
-
Syntax Support: Generative models can serve as reliable resources for syntax validation within various programming languages. They provide real-time assistance while coding, ensuring that errors are minimized before finalizing projects.
Practical Steps to Transform Thoughts into Actions
To effectively turn ideas into actionable steps, consider implementing these strategies:
Define Clear Objectives
Establish specific goals you aim to achieve with your project. Clear objectives help prioritize tasks and allocate resources efficiently.
Break Down Tasks
Divide larger projects into smaller, manageable components. This approach not only simplifies execution but also allows for tracking progress more easily.
Utilize Feedback Loops
Solicit feedback regularly throughout the development process. Engaging peers or mentors can provide new insights that refine your approach and lead to better outcomes.
Adopt Agile Methodologies
Embrace iterative development practices that focus on rapid prototyping and continuous improvement. Agile methodologies allow teams to adapt quickly to changes while maintaining a focus on delivering functional products.
Document Your Process
Maintain comprehensive documentation throughout your projects. This practice not only aids current efforts but also serves as a valuable reference for future initiatives.
Conclusion
Transforming thoughts into actionable results is an essential competency in today’s fast-paced technological landscape. By leveraging contextual understanding, utilizing advanced tools like IDEs and generative AI models, defining clear objectives, breaking down tasks effectively, engaging in feedback loops, adopting agile methodologies, and documenting processes thoroughly, individuals can significantly enhance their ability to execute ideas successfully.
This systematic approach ensures that innovative thoughts evolve beyond mere concepts into meaningful actions that drive progress across various domains of technology and artificial intelligence.

Leave a Reply